| Description: |
Oxford Movement, Stanford University, 1930s; member, Communist Party of the United States of America, 1930s and 40s: organizing political theater, unions and labor schools in California's farm areas, expulsion for homosexuality, House Un-American Affairs Committee; gay rights activist, 1950s-80s: promoting gay rights legislation and support groups.
